on a 300ex with a stock engine exept for pipe air filter and jets will a rev box do anything noticably or just let my bike rev higher?
is it worth spending my money bassically?

It won't do much, unless you have a high duration/ high lift cam, and a high compression piston. Now if your planing on doing motor work in the future, do it. But if you not I would buy a 40oex carb or something like that.
